Spanish
This introductory module is designed to enable the student to understand and use everyday
expressions and basic phrases.
In order to earn the 5 QQI / European Credit Transfer System credits that attach to this
module students would need to pass the in-class assessment including 30% oral.

Spanish Course Structure
Contexts / themes that will be used include the following:
-
Speaking and Interaction – give a short rehearsed basic presentation on a familiar subject and answer straightforward follow-up questions
-
Writing - write simple short phrases
-
Listening - generally identify the topic of and understand the main point of discussion between native speakers when it is conducted slowly and clearly
-
Reading - understand short simple texts
Spanish Entry Requirements
Applicants should have completed Spanish (Level I).
Leaving Certificate or equivalent. Students over 23 years of age may be exempted from this
requirement if they can demonstrate that they are suitable candidates for the course of study.
